Guangfu: 2,600 years old, birthplace of tai chi
By Liu Xiang | China Daily | Updated: 2012-08-10 07:53
A traditional Chinese therapeutic exercise combining kung fu and the qigong breathing exercise, the popularity of tai chi has spread across the world from Guangfu, where today even toddlers and the very aged continue its practice. Provided to China Daily |
The ancient town of Guangfu, in Yongnian county, Hebei province might be as unknown to the outside world as millions of other settlements in China except for a singular fact - it is the birthplace of tai chi.
